What does a remote power electronics intern do?

A Remote Power Electronics Intern assists engineering teams in designing, testing, and analyzing power electronic systems and components, such as converters, inverters, and power supplies, while working remotely. Interns often use simulation software, create technical documentation, and help with data analysis or troubleshooting under supervision. This role allows students or recent graduates to gain practical experience in the field of power electronics, often while collaborating virtually with professionals and attending remote meetings or training sessions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ote power electronics int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Power Electronics Intern, you need a solid understanding of circuit theory, power electronics fundamentals, and relevant coursework in electrical engineering. Familiarity with simulation tools like MATLAB/Simulink, SPICE, and proficiency in CAD software are typically required, along with experience using laboratory equipment. Strong problem-solving abilities, self-motivation, and effective remote communication skills help interns stand out in this position. These skills and qualities are essential for successfully contributing to projects, collaborating with teams remotely, and applying technical knowledge to real-world challenges.

What types of projects and responsibilities can a remote power electronics intern expect during their internship?

As a Remote Power Electronics Intern, you can expect to work on projects such as designing, simulating, and testing power electronic circuits, as well as supporting the development of prototypes and conducting research on new technologies. Daily tasks often include analyzing circuit performance, creating technical documentation, and collaborating with senior engineers through virtual meetings and project management tools. Interns are typically encouraged to ask questions and contribute ideas, making this a valuable opportunity to build technical skills and gain insight into the industry’s workflow.

What is the difference between Remote Power Electronics Intern vs Remote Electrical Engineering Intern?

AspectRemote Power Electronics InternRemote Electrical Engineering Intern
Required CredentialsEnrolled in Electrical Engineering or related field, basic knowledge of power electronicsEnrolled in Electrical Engineering or related field, foundational electrical knowledge
Work EnvironmentRemote, often in tech or manufacturing companies focusing on power systemsRemote, in various industries including energy, manufacturing, and tech
Industry UsageSpecific to power electronics, renewable energy, and power systemsBroader, covering general electrical systems and circuits

The Remote Power Electronics Intern focuses specifically on power electronic devices and systems, requiring knowledge in power conversion and control. The Remote Electrical Engineering Intern has a broader scope, covering general electrical systems. Both roles are remote, often in tech or energy sectors, but the Power Electronics Intern specializes in power systems, making it more niche within electrical engineering.

Acuity Inc. (NYSE: AYI) is a market-leading industrial technology company. We use technology to solve problems in spaces, light and more things to come. Through our two business segments, Acuity Brands Lighting (ABL) and Acuity Intelligent Spaces (AIS), we design, manufacture, and bring to market products and services that make a valuable difference in people's lives. 

We achieve growth through the development of innovative new products and services, including lighting, lighting controls, building management solutions, and an audio, video and control platform. We focus on customer outcomes and drive growth and productivity to increase market share and deliver superior returns. We look to aggressively deploy capital to grow the business and to enter attractive new verticals. 

Acuity Inc. is based in Atlanta, Georgia, with operations across North America, Europe and Asia. The Company is powered by approximately 13,000 dedicated and talented associates. Visit us at www.acuityinc.com. 

Job Summary

The Brand and Product Marketing Manager, nLight and Software, reporting to the Director of Marketing Controls - Electronics, is responsible for developing and assessing the brand and product positioning messages, audience-based communications including promotional programs, and product releases. The Brand and Product Marketing Manager is a curious, productivity-oriented and results driven individual with strong project management skills, who leverages data, research, understanding and collaboration to formulate recommendations and drive action plans to on-point messaging, on-time delivery, and on-budget. Responsible for assessing the nLight & Software brand, product, and customer value within the ecosystem within the lighting controls and connected building ecosystem to develop clear positioning, compelling messaging, and effective communication strategies. This role articulates brand and product value consistently through asset creation and communication tactics, while delivering on company, team, and personal performance objectives in collaboration with marketing, product management, sales, and other cross-functional partners.
